Jervon Hicks, a life coach for CRED, said that African American kids were dying by murder, by gunfire in Roseland, Chicago, at such a brutal rate that in order to view dead friends he'd need a “drive-thru mortuary.” 3/10 - C-Span “Jan 1, 2018 - Chicago police count fewer murders in 2017, but still 650 people were killed. ... Chicago saw nearly a 16% decline in murders in 2017 from the previous year, according to statistics released in the early hours of New Year's Day.” - CNN “Chicago CRED (Creating Real Economic Destiny) was created in 2016 by Emerson Collective, a social impact organization founded and run by Laurene Powell Jobs, along with former U.S. Education Secretary and Chicago Public Schools CEO Arne Duncan.” Wendy Jones and Roger Jones run CRED's Youth Peace Center.* – Chicago Cred/ * Emerson Collective Please see Carbuncle Moon post of 10/12/17: The Northern Ireland Effect...
